Akshay Kumar rides a limited edition bike in 'Singh is Bliing'

  • IndiaGlitz, [Friday,September 18 2015]

Akshay Kumar is known to be quite a bike enthusiast. Rather than travelling by cars, he has been known to have taken his co-stars zooming across the city during promotions on his bike. The team of his next, 'Singh is Bling', made sure he got his own custom-made bike during the shoot of a romantic song sequence with leading lady Amy Jackson in Romania.

A source from the team reveals, "During the shoot of the movie in Romania, a special bike was called for. It was a blazing red one. Akshay got very fascinated with the bike and after the shoot was done, he took it for a ride with co-star Amy. The beautiful machine was a limited edition one and was customised for the shoot. It was interesting to see Akshay excited like a little boy as he checked out the features and considered the possibility of buying a similar one for himself."

Produced by Ashvini Yardi and Co- produced by Akshay Jayantilal Gada, Kushal Kantilal Gada and Reshmaa Kadakia. Dhaval Jayantilal Gada (Pen) & Grazing Goat pictures LLP Presents, starring Akshay Kumar and Amy Jackson in lead roles, 'Singh is Bliing' directed by Prabhudheva is all set to release on 2nd October.
